Hello List

I am having a problem with a Full Package Build. Last full package
build was in January and everything worked fine. I have installed the
YearEnd ASU for Payroll and now I can't seem to get the Full Package to
build correctly. The R9622 - Looks fine - Spec Build Status' are all
successful and the Package Build Status is Build Completed Successfully.
After I deploy the package to the server, it seems as if there was not
change to the applications. As if the specs were not transfered.

After reviewing the last good package build, the buildlog.txt has a
section that starts with the below line - the new package stops before
beginning the makefile generation.

Generating Makefile: e:\JDEdwardsOneWorld\B733\PLANNER\obj\CBUSPART.mak
Makefile generated.

Any idea what could have happened to make the package builds stop at
this point???

Hi Lori
If you are using NT/SQL, it may that your environmental variables on the
Enterprise Server are not set correctly.

Hi Lori,
My 2c (CAD :)
I would look for hard drive available space, too ...
Get the KG Minimum Requirements, multiply them by say 2.0 (safety coefficient), then compare it with your Workstation's specs.
